Core Viewpoint - The introduction of the "zero tariff" policy for imported consumer goods in Hainan Free Trade Port aims to enhance the living standards of local residents and promote the development of the free trade port by allowing tax-free purchases of specified goods [1][4]. Group 1: Policy Details - The policy allows residents of Hainan to purchase imported goods at designated locations without paying import duties, value-added tax, or consumption tax, with an annual tax-free limit of 10,000 yuan per person [1][4]. - The list of eligible goods focuses on daily consumer products, including food and beverages, daily necessities, household items, and maternal and infant products [1][4]. - The policy is effective immediately upon announcement and is aimed at providing tangible benefits to residents, reflecting the government's commitment to high-standard development of the free trade port [1][4]. Group 2: Target Audience and Rationale - The beneficiaries of the policy are limited to residents of Hainan, including Chinese citizens with Hainan ID cards, residence permits, or social security cards, as well as foreign individuals living and working in Hainan [2]. - The rationale behind this limitation is to align with the overall design principles of the Hainan Free Trade Port, which emphasize local consumption and support for residents [2]. Group 3: Impact and Significance - The policy represents a significant breakthrough in allowing local residents to purchase imported daily consumer goods tax-free, marking a historical shift from previous tax exemption policies that were primarily tourism-focused [4]. - The implementation of strict regulatory measures and penalties for violations aims to ensure the smooth operation of the policy and prevent abuse, such as resale or smuggling of zero-tariff goods [4].
